The open systems interconnection osi model is a conceptual and logical layout that defines network communication used by systems open to interconnection and communication with other systems.
Before the concept of the open system interconnection model, networking was managed by the usa government arpanet and the french government cyclades and a few organizations like ibm and digital equipment corporation. Osi had two major components, an abstract model of networking, called the basic reference model or sevenlayer model, and a set of specific protocols. Osi reference model the international standards organization iso proposal for the standardization of the various protocols used in computer networks specifically those networks used to connect open systems is called the open systems interconnection reference model1984, or simply the osi model.
